
The City of Fishers is bustling with pre-Valentine's Day activities this weekend, and the Fishers, Indiana Government has shared a list of the top five events to enjoy. If you're looking to spread some love, the Humane Society for Hamilton County (Indiana) is offering an opportunity to purchase a valentine for a shelter pet. In exchange for your kindness, you'll be sent a video of the pet enjoying a special Valentine's dinner, the organization shared on social media.
For those who fancy a dash of art in their lives, a Make It Take It class at the Fishers Art Center this Saturday may be the perfect fit. The class will focus on crafting needle felted hearts, which could make for a unique date night experience. Sports enthusiasts can cheer on the Indy Fuel as they take on the Fort Wayne Komets on Saturday night at 7 p.m., providing a rush of competitive energy to fans.
Sunday continues the weekend excitement with the Cupid Cornhole Tournament at the Fishers Community Center from 1 - 4 p.m. Teams interested in participating are encouraged to register in advance via the community center's website. Additionally, Fishers Junior high offers an #OpenGym session from 1 - 5 p.m. this Sunday. It's an opportunity to get active and mingle with fellow residents, though participants under 18 must have a waiver signed.
